sm-engine-test

Community

Test patterns for Source Monitor engine.

Authordchuk
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Developers creating and maintaining tests for the Source Monitor engine often rely on ad hoc helpers and patterns. This Skill provides a centralized set of test patterns, reusable helpers, and guidance to ensure consistent, isolated tests with WebMock and VCR, speeding debugging and quality checks.

Core Features & Use Cases

  • Built-in test helpers such as create_source!, with_queue_adapter, setup_once, and clean_source_monitor_tables!.
  • Guidance for integrating WebMock and VCR, test isolation best practices, and parallel test setup.
  • Use cases include accelerating test suite bootstrapping, debugging test failures, and verifying test behavior across multiple environments.

Quick Start

Review the engine test patterns and apply the included helpers to your tests.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: sm-engine-test
Download link: https://github.com/dchuk/source_monitor/archive/main.zip#sm-engine-test

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.